Malingering is intentionally fabricating a physical or mental disorder for personal gain. Assume you are a prosecutor who has received a forensic mental health evaluation for a defendant charged with a violent crime; however, you suspect the defendant may be malingering. What evidence would you look for to confirm or dispel your suspicions? Do you think there is any way to prove someone is malingering definitively?
